163/*
164 * ls_recover_flags:
165 *
166 * DFL_BLOCK_LOCKS: dlm is in recovery and will grant locks that had been
167 * held by failed nodes whose journals need recovery. Those locks should
168 * only be used for journal recovery until the journal recovery is done.
169 * This is set by the dlm recover_prep callback and cleared by the
170 * gfs2_control thread when journal recovery is complete. To avoid
171 * races between recover_prep setting and gfs2_control clearing, recover_spin
172 * is held while changing this bit and reading/writing recover_block
173 * and recover_start.
174 *
175 * DFL_NO_DLM_OPS: dlm lockspace ops/callbacks are not being used.
176 *
177 * DFL_FIRST_MOUNT: this node is the first to mount this fs and is doing
178 * recovery of all journals before allowing other nodes to mount the fs.
179 * This is cleared when FIRST_MOUNT_DONE is set.
180 *
181 * DFL_FIRST_MOUNT_DONE: this node was the first mounter, and has finished
182 * recovery of all journals, and now allows other nodes to mount the fs.
183 *
184 * DFL_MOUNT_DONE: gdlm_mount has completed successfully and cleared
185 * BLOCK_LOCKS for the first time. The gfs2_control thread should now
186 * control clearing BLOCK_LOCKS for further recoveries.
187 *
188 * DFL_UNMOUNT: gdlm_unmount sets to keep sdp off gfs2_control_wq.
189 *
190 * DFL_DLM_RECOVERY: set while dlm is in recovery, between recover_prep()
191 * and recover_done(), i.e. set while recover_block == recover_start.
192 */
